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Linz to Gaming is to drive which costs €15 - €22 and takes 1h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Linz to Gaming is to drive which takes 1h 16m and costs €15 - €22.
The distance between Linz and Gaming is 109 km. The road distance is 92.5 km.
The best way to get from Linz to Gaming without a car is to train and bus which takes 2h 41m and costs €17 - €60.
It takes approximately 2h 41m to get from Linz to Gaming,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Linz to Gaming is 93 km. It takes approximately 1h 16m to drive from Linz to Gaming.

What companies run services between Linz, Austria and Gaming, Lower Austria?
There is no direct connection from Linz to Gaming. However, you can take the train to Amstetten Noe, walk to Amstetten Bahnhof, then take the bus to Gaming Rathaus. Alternatively, you can take a train from Linz Hbf to Gaming Rathaus via Amstetten Noe, Poechlarn, Scheibbs, and Scheibbs Bahnhof in around 3h 45m.
